Piaggio India has rolled out the BS6 compliant versions of the Aprilia and Vespa scooters in the country. The scooters now get a high performance 160 cc single-cylinder engine that is now fuel-injected in order to meet the upcoming stringent emission norms. With the new powertrain, the Aprilia SR 150 has been rebadged as the Aprilia SR 160. The new Aprilia SR 160 now starts from ₹ 85,431, which is about ₹ 10,000 more expensive than the older version. The new BS6 Vespa 150 SXL, meanwhile, starts at ₹ 91,492 (all-prices, ex-showroom Pune).
The new 160 cc Vespa and Aprilia scooters are available at dealerships pan India and the company will soon introduce the 125 cc scooter range as well by January 2020. This includes the Vespa range as well as the Aprilis SR 125.
